Localizing an application to other languages


URLs do not contain locale information. The system determines the correct locale in the following ways:

  • If the user is not logged in, the system uses the browser's preferred locale list in prioritized order to try to match the closest locale. The World Wide Web Consortium (W3C) recommends this method for choosing a locale for a web page.
  • If the user is logged in, the system uses the user's preferences to set the locale. If no locale is set in the user preferences, then the system uses the browser-supplied list.
